VAT isn't just about charging 20% and passing it to HMRC — there are multiple schemes (Standard, Flat Rate, Cash Accounting), each with different rules on when you pay and how much you can reclaim. Choose the wrong one, and you could be paying significantly more VAT than necessary, or triggering unwanted HMRC scrutiny. On top of scheme selection, Making Tax Digital now requires VAT-registered businesses to keep digital records and file returns through compatible software — manual spreadsheets or paper records are no longer acceptable. Missed quarterly deadlines trigger a points-based penalty system, and persistent late filing can escalate into fines. Add in threshold monitoring (currently £90,000 taxable turnover) and the risk of accidentally under- or over-registering, and VAT quickly becomes one of the easiest areas to get wrong without expert oversight.

You must register once your taxable turnover exceeds £90,000 in any rolling 12-month period. You can also register voluntarily below this threshold.
Under the Standard scheme, you pay HMRC the difference between VAT charged and VAT reclaimed. Under Flat Rate, you pay a fixed percentage of turnover but can’t reclaim VAT on most purchases — the right choice depends on your expenses.
Yes — MTD requires digital record-keeping and submission through compatible software like Xero, QuickBooks, or FreeAgent. Manual or spreadsheet-based filing is no longer accepted for most VAT-registered businesses.
HMRC operates a points-based penalty system — persistent late filing accumulates points that eventually trigger a financial penalty, plus interest on any VAT paid late.
